Mendenhall Campground

The trail leaves from the Skaters Cabin parking lot (Skater’s Cabin Road, Juneau, AK 99801). The terrain is generally flat, with a full loop (skiing all sections) ~3 km. Shorter loops can be skied by cutting out various sections. Skiers with dogs should keep them under control and clean up after them. There is an outhouse next to Skaters Cabin, as well as one or two outhouses open out on the trail (the Forest Service typically marks which ones remain open). Parking is in front of Skaters Cabin, with overflow parking down by the Tolch Rock and West Glacier Trailheads (~.25 and .5 kilometers, respectivelly, continuing to the end of the road). A connector trail back to the Campground parallels the road for ~.5 km. Juneau, AK 99801.
